Taro Logo

Trading Systems Engineer

A diversified trading firm with over 3 decades of experience in global markets, operating with their own capital and trading various asset classes.
Backend
Mid-Level Software Engineer
In-Person
1,000 - 5,000 Employees
3+ years of experience
Finance

Description For Trading Systems Engineer

DRW is a well-established trading firm with a 30-year track record of excellence in global markets. As a Trading Systems Engineer, you'll join their Application Support team, playing a crucial role in maintaining and optimizing their trading infrastructure. The position combines technical expertise with business acumen, requiring strong skills in Linux systems, SQL, and trading protocols.

The role involves supporting mission-critical trading systems across various asset classes, including equities, fixed income, and cryptoassets. You'll be responsible for ensuring maximum system availability, troubleshooting complex technical issues, and developing automation tools to enhance operational efficiency. The position requires a blend of technical knowledge and business understanding, as you'll be working directly with traders and various technical teams.

DRW offers a unique environment where you'll work with sophisticated technology while having the autonomy to make impactful decisions. The company trades using its own capital, allowing for quick pivots to capture market opportunities. They've expanded beyond traditional trading into real estate, venture capital, and cryptoassets, providing diverse exposure to different markets and technologies.

The ideal candidate should have a Computer Science degree, strong troubleshooting skills, and experience with trading systems and protocols. You'll need to be comfortable working in a fast-paced environment, handling pressure effectively, and maintaining clear communication across global teams. The role offers the opportunity to work with cutting-edge trading technology while contributing to a firm that values innovation and integrity.

Working at DRW means joining a company that emphasizes respect, curiosity, and open-mindedness. The role requires participation in rotating on-call coverage, reflecting the 24/7 nature of global markets. This position is perfect for someone who thrives in a challenging environment and wants to be at the intersection of technology and financial markets.

Last updated 3 months ago

Responsibilities For Trading Systems Engineer

  • Establish best-in-class production support and efficient software deployment
  • Ensure maximum trading system availability
  • Provide support for trading groups' production systems across asset classes
  • Develop proprietary process automation and monitoring tools
  • Troubleshoot trading system production incidents
  • Automate software configuration and rollout procedures
  • Support core market connectivity and correspond with exchanges
  • Collaborate with various teams globally
  • Build documentation for procedures and system architecture
  • Coordinate with global support teams in 24x7 environment

Requirements For Trading Systems Engineer

Linux
  • B.S. in Computer Science or equivalent degree
  • Superior troubleshooting skills
  • Experience with FIX protocol and alternative exchange protocols
  • SQL experience including queries/updates/table creation
  • Linux & Windows platform support experience
  • Experience supporting electronic trading systems
  • Knowledge of network communications including multicast networking
  • Strong communication skills
  • Self-motivation and intellectual curiosity
  • Ability to handle pressure and time constraints

Interested in this job?

Jobs Related To DRW Trading Systems Engineer